Understanding Presbyopia and Its Impact

As we age, a common physiological change occurs: presbyopia. This natural condition affects the eye's ability to focus on close-up objects. For many, it's an undeniable signal that it's time to consider vision correction with reading glasses.

The "Old Eye" Phenomenon: Greek Origins and Relatability

The term "presbyopia" itself carries a fascinating history, originating from the Greek word for “old eye,” according to the American Academy of Ophthalmology. This ancient designation perfectly captures the experience of a natural shift in our vision. Many individuals vividly recall the sudden, almost jarring realization: "Reader, I needed readers." It's a universal experience, marking a new phase in visual perception.

This phenomenon is not merely about age; it's about the lens of the eye gradually losing its flexibility. This reduced elasticity makes it harder to shift focus between different distances, leading to blurred vision for tasks like reading or working on a computer. Mixed Evidence on Blue Light Glasses Effectiveness

While the benefits of reducing digital eye strain are clear, the scientific evidence on the effectiveness of blue light glasses remains mixed. Mark Fromer, MD, a New York-based ophthalmologist, points out that research has yielded varying conclusions. A comprehensive review conducted in 2021 found no definitive proof that blue-light-blocking glasses conclusively help with all negative effects of exposure. Furthermore, additional studies have shown little difference between the perceived benefits of blue light glasses and placebo glasses.

Despite these mixed results, one crucial factor stands out: blue light blockers do not appear to have any negative effects. This means that for individuals seeking potential relief from digital eye strain relief glasses or those who spend significant time in front of screens, trying blue light reading glasses poses no harm. Magnification Levels and Progressive Options

When considering traditional readers eyewear, magnification levels for readers are crucial. The strength of reading glasses, also known as "diopter," typically begins at +1.00 and increases incrementally, often by quarter steps, up to +3.50 or even +4.00. This precise progression allows users to find the exact vision correction needed for their specific degree of presbyopia. Beyond single-vision readers, many brands now offer progressive versions. These innovative lenses provide a seamless visual experience, with the top portion being clear for distance vision and the bottom section offering magnification for close-up tasks. This eliminates the need to constantly switch between different pairs of glasses, offering continuous clarity for varying distances. Key Features for Effective Blue Light Blocking

Blue light blocking glasses come with various lens options. Lenses with a yellow or amber tint are specifically engineered to block a higher percentage of blue light, making them ideal for individuals who spend extensive hours in front of screens. These tinted optical aids can significantly reduce visual fatigue. Conversely, clear lenses offer a more subtle form of blue light protection, suitable for general use without altering color perception. To assess the effectiveness of your anti-glare reading glasses or blue light readers, James Dello Russo, OD, suggests a simple at-home test: if the light reflection on the lens appears blue when held up to a light source, it likely possesses some degree of blue light-blocking capability. Expert Recommendations for Strength Assessment

According to Dr. Inna Lazar, a comprehensive approach to finding your ideal **magnification levels for readers** begins with professional guidance. She strongly advises determining your precise needs through a "yearly comprehensive eye exam" with your optometrist or eye doctor. This professional assessment can identify underlying conditions and provide an accurate prescription for your specific **optical aids**.

For a practical, immediate at-home method, especially for those unsure about their current prescription, a simple test can be conducted. You can try on different strengths of **magnification devices** available at a local drugstore. The goal is to find the pair with which you can clearly read text messages or other small print at a standard font size and comfortable arm's length. This helps you narrow down the range of suitable **magnification strengths**.

Key Fit Considerations for All-Day Wear

Ensuring a proper fit for your **eyewear solutions** is vital for all-day comfort. Dr. Inna Lazar emphasizes that the frames "won’t be too tight on the sides of your head," preventing uncomfortable pressure. Additionally, pay close attention to how the nose bridge sits; it should look and feel comfortable, evenly distributing the weight of the **reading glasses**. Reputable online retailers for **optical aids** often provide detailed frame size measurements, including lens width, bridge width, and temple length, allowing you to compare them with your current favorite **vision aids** for an accurate match.

Beyond dimensions, the best **reading glasses** should feel lightweight, fitting snugly on your nose without slipping. Look for designs that feature non-slip nose pads and temple pads. These crucial components prevent the **magnification devices** from sliding down your face during extended use, ensuring they stay securely in place whether you're reading a book or working on a computer.

Essential Lens Coatings for Enhanced Experience: anti-glare reading glasses

To further enhance your reading experience and protect your eyes, consider the various lens coatings available for **readers eyewear**. Opting for lenses with **anti-glare reading glasses** coatings significantly reduces reflections from light sources, improving clarity and reducing visual fatigue. Anti-reflective properties work similarly, minimizing distracting glare.

Additionally, a scratch-resistant finish is highly recommended for longevity, protecting your **optical aids** from daily wear and tear.
